A new series of novel triclosan (2,4,4'-trichloro-2'-hydroxydiphenylether) analogues were designed, synthesized, and screened for their in vitro antimycobacterial and antibacterial activities. Most of the compounds showed significant activity against Mycobacterium tuberculosis H37Rv strain with minimum inhibitory concentration (MIC) values in 20-40 µM range in GAST/Fe medium when compared with triclosan (43 µM) in the first week of assay, and after additional incubation, seven compounds, that is, 2a, 2c, 2g, 2h, 2i, 2j, and 2m, exhibited MIC values at the concentration of 20-40 µM. The compounds also showed more significant activity against Bacillus subtilis and Staphylococcus aureus. The synthesized compounds showed druggable properties, and the predicted ADME (absorption, distribution, metabolism, and excretion) properties were within the acceptable limits. The in silico studies predicted better interactions of compounds with target protein residues and a higher dock score in comparison with triclosan. Molecular dynamics simulation study of the most active compound 2i was performed in order to further explore the stability of the protein-ligand complex and the protein-ligand interaction in detail.

A series of novel 2-amino-4-(3-hydroxy-4-phenoxyphenyl)-6-(4-substituted phenyl) nicotinonitriles were synthesized and evaluated against HepG2, A-549 and Vero cell lines. Compounds 3b (IC50 16.74 ± 0.45 µM) and 3p (IC50 10.57 ± 0.54 µM) were found to be the most active compounds against A-549 cell line among the evaluated compounds. Further 3b- and 3p-induced apoptosis was characterized by AO/EB (acridine orange/ethidium bromide) nuclear staining method and also by DNA fragmentation study. A decrease in cell viability and initiation of apoptosis was clearly evident through the morphological changes in the A-549 cells treated with 3b and 3p when stained with this method. Fragmentation of DNA into nucleosomes was observed which further confirmed the cell apoptosis in cells treated with compound 3b. Flow cytometry studies confirmed the cell cycle arrest at G2/M phase in A549 cells treated with compound 3b. Further in silico studies performed supported the in vitro anticancer activity of these compounds as depicted by dock score and binding energy values.

A needs analysis study for curriculum reform in basic sciences was conducted at Melaka Manipal Medical College, India, by means of a formative assessment method, namely Basic Science Retention Examination (BSRE). Students participated in a BSRE, which comprised recall and clinical multiple-choice questions in six discipline areas. They also rated the clinical relevance of each question and provided responses to three open-text questions about the exam. Pass rates were determined; clinical relevance ratings and performance scores were compared between recall type and clinical questions to test students' level of clinical application of basic science knowledge. Text comments were thematically analyzed to identify recurring themes. Only one-third of students passed the BSRE (32.2%). Students performed better in recall questions compared with clinical questions in anatomy (51.0 vs. 40.2%), pathology (45.1 vs. 38.1%), pharmacology (41.8 vs. 31.7%), and biochemistry (43.5 vs. 26.9%). In physiology, students performed better in clinical questions compared with the recall type (56.2 vs. 45.8%). Students' response to BSRE was positive. The findings imply that transfer of basic science knowledge was poor, and that assessment methods should emphasize clinical application of basic science knowledge.

BACKGROUND: Poultry farming and consumption of poultry (Gallus gallus domesticus) meat and eggs are common gastronomical practices worldwide. Till now, a detailed understanding about the gut colonisation of Gallus gallus domesticus by yeasts and their virulence properties and drug resistance patterns in available literature remain sparse. This study was undertaken to explore this prevalent issue. RESULTS: A total of 103 specimens of fresh droppings of broiler chickens (commercial G domesticus) and domesticated chickens (domesticated G domesticus) were collected from the breeding sites. The isolates comprised of 29 (33%) Debaryozyma hansenii (Candida famata), 12 (13.6%) Sporothrix catenata (C. ciferrii), 10 (11.4%) C. albicans, 8 (9.1%) Diutnia catenulata (C. catenulate), 6 (6.8%) C. tropicalis, 3 (3.4%) Candida acidothermophilum (C. krusei), 2 (2.3%) C. pintolopesii, 1 (1.1%) C. parapsilosis, 9 (10.2%) Trichosporon spp. (T. moniliiforme, T. asahii), 4 (4.5%) Geotrichum candidum, 3 (3.4%) Cryptococcus macerans and 1 (1%) Cystobasidium minuta (Rhodotorula minuta). Virulence factors, measured among different yeast species, showed wide variability. Biofilm cells exhibited higher Minimum Inhibitory Concentration (MIC) values (µg/ml) than planktonic cells against all antifungal compounds tested: (fluconazole, 8-512 vs 0.031-16; amphotericin B, 0.5-64 vs 0.031-16; voriconazole 0.062-16 vs 0.062-8; caspofungin, 0.062-4 vs 0.031-1). CONCLUSIONS: The present work extends the current understanding of in vitro virulence factors and antifungal susceptibility pattern of gastrointestinal yeast flora of G domesticus. More studies with advanced techniques are needed to quantify the risk of spread of these potential pathogens to environment and human.

To determine the distribution and relationship of antimicrobial resistance determinants among extended-spectrum-cephalosporin (ESC)-resistant or carbapenem-resistant Escherichia coli isolates from the aquatic environment in India, water samples were collected from rivers or sewage treatment plants in five Indian states. A total of 446 E. coli isolates were randomly obtained. Resistance to ESC and/or carbapenem was observed in 169 (37.9%) E. coli isolates, which were further analyzed. These isolates showed resistance to numerous antimicrobials; more than half of the isolates exhibited resistance to eight or more antimicrobials. The blaNDM gene was detected in 14/21 carbapenem-resistant E. coli isolates: blaNDM-1 in 2 isolates, blaNDM-5 in 7 isolates, and blaNDM-7 in 5 isolates. The blaCTX-M gene was detected in 112 isolates (66.3%): blaCTX-M-15 in 108 isolates and blaCTX-M-55 in 4 isolates. We extracted 49 plasmids from selected isolates, and their whole-genome sequences were determined. Fifty resistance genes were detected, and 11 different combinations of replicon types were observed among the 49 plasmids. The network analysis results suggested that the plasmids sharing replicon types tended to form a community, which is based on the predicted gene similarity among the plasmids. Four communities each containing from 4 to 17 plasmids were observed. Three of the four communities contained plasmids detected in different Indian states, suggesting that the interstate dissemination of ancestor plasmids has already occurred. Comparison of the DNA sequences of the blaNDM-positive plasmids detected in this study with known sequences of related plasmids suggested that various mutation events facilitated the evolution of the plasmids and that plasmids with similar genetic backgrounds have widely disseminated in India.

Clinical diagnosis of scrub typhus is often difficult because the symptoms are very similar to those of other febrile illness such as dengue, leptospirosis, malaria and other viral hemorrhagic fevers. Though better diagnostic tests are available for rickettsial diseases and scrub typhus elsewhere, the Weil-Felix test is still commonly used in India, mainly because microimmunofluorescence assays (M-IFA) were not available in India till recently and relevant staff had insufficient training. The present study was performed to investigate the performance of M-IFA, IgM ELISA, and Weil-Felix test on 546 non-repeated serum samples from subjects suspected of having scrub typhus. One hundred and forty-three of these 546 samples were positive by M-IFA; these cases were also confirmed clinically to have scrub typhus based on their dramatic responses to doxycycline therapy. IgM ELISA was positive in 122 of the 143 M-IFA positive cases and the Weil-Felix test in 96. Though the Weil-Felix test is a heterophile agglutination test, it was found in this study to have good specificity but far too little sensitivity to use as a routine diagnostic test. IgM ELISA can be a good substitute for M-IFA. Incorporation of multiple prototype antigens on M-IFA slides is likely one of the reasons for its superior performance. As newer and better diagnostic assays become available for scrub typhus diagnosis in developed countries, it will be imperative to also use such tests in other endemic countries to prevent over- or under-diagnosis of scrub typhus.

The sewage treatment plant (STP) is one of the most important interfaces between the human population and the aquatic environment, leading to contamination of the latter by antimicrobial-resistant bacteria. To identify factors affecting the prevalence of antimicrobial-resistant bacteria, water samples were collected from three different STPs in South India. STP1 exclusively treats sewage generated by a domestic population. STP2 predominantly treats sewage generated by a domestic population with a mix of hospital effluent. STP3 treats effluents generated exclusively by a hospital. The water samples were collected between three intermediate treatment steps including equalization, aeration, and clarification, in addition to the outlet to assess the removal rates of bacteria as the effluent passed through the treatment plant. The samples were collected in three different seasons to study the effect of seasonal variation. Escherichia coli isolated from the water samples were tested for susceptibility to 12 antimicrobials. The results of logistic regression analysis suggest that the hospital wastewater inflow significantly increased the prevalence of antimicrobial-resistant E. coli, whereas the treatment processes and sampling seasons did not affect the prevalence of these isolates. A bias in the genotype distribution of E. coli was observed among the isolates obtained from STP3. In conclusion, hospital wastewaters should be carefully treated to prevent the contamination of Indian environment with antimicrobial-resistant bacteria.

BACKGROUND: We studied the urinary abnormalities and acute kidney injury (AKI) as per RIFLE criteria in scrub typhus. METHODS: A prospective case record-based study of scrub typhus was carried out from January 2009 to December 2010 in a tertiary hospital in South India. Patients were followed up until renal recovery or for at least 3 months after discharge. Univariate, chi-squared tests and multivariate logistic regression analyses were performed to identify the predictors of AKI. RESULTS: Scrub typhus was diagnosed in 259 patients. Urinary abnormalities were seen in 147 patients (56.7%) with 60 patients (23.2%) having AKI. All AKI patients had urinary abnormalities and 17 (28.3%) were oliguric. Applying RIFLE (risk, injury, failure, loss, end-stage kidney disease) criteria, R, I, F were present in 23 (38.33%), 13 (21.67%), and 24 patients (40%), respectively. Creatine phosphokinase (CPK) was raised in 33 patients (55%) and hemodialysis was required in 6 patients (10%). The case fatality rate in this study was 2 out of 259 (0.77%), both having AKI and others recovering clinically. Significant predictors of AKI were tachycardia [odds ratio (OR) 2.28], breathlessness (OR 2.281), intensive care requirement (OR 2.43), mechanical ventilation (OR 3.33), thrombocytopenia (OR 2.90) and CPK>80 U/L (OR 1.76) by univariate analysis and intensive care requirement (adjusted OR 2.89) and thrombocytopenia (AOR 2.28) by multivariable logistic regression. CONCLUSION: Scrub typhus should be part of the differential diagnosis of acute febrile illness with AKI. AKI in scrub typhus is usually mild, non-oliguric, and renal recovery occurs in most patients. Rhabdomyolysis may be contributory to AKI. Thrombocytopenia and intensive care requirement are significant predictors of AKI in scrub typhus.

OBJECTIVE: The objective of this study was to detect C. difficile in patients presenting with Antibiotic Associated Diarrhoea. METHODS: Stool samples from twenty-five patients collected over a period of four months were processed for C. difficile by culture and the isolates were identified following standard methods. C. difficile toxins A and B and C. perfringens enterotoxin were detected by ELISA performed directly on stool specimens. RESULTS: Four patients (16%) were found positive for C. difficile infection. All patients with C. difficile infection received prior treatment with third-generation cephalosporins or beta-lactam/beta-lactamase inhibitor antibiotics. C. perfringens enterotoxin was found in two (8%) patients. Severe colitis was seen in one (25%) of the four patients who had co-infection with C. difficile and C. perfringens. CONCLUSION: This study demonstrated a significant occurrence of C. difficile infection in this hospital population. There is a need to further evaluate the role of C. perfringens in causing antibiotic associated diarrhoea. Good clinical and laboratory studies to generate local epidemiological data are essential to increase awareness among the treating clinicians about C. difficile infection. Also limited and rational use of broad spectrum antibiotics is recommended.

OBJECTIVES: We evaluated the usefulness of interleukin-6 (IL-6) and C-reactive protein (CRP) at the onset of febrile neutropenia and 72 hours later, in identifying risk groups and assessing response to antibiotic therapy. METHODS: All episodes of febrile neutropenia were divided in 3 study groups-microbiologically documented infection (MDI), clinically documented infection (CDI), and fever of unknown origin (FUO). Three outcome groups were defined as those responding to first-line antibiotics (R1), those responding to second-line antibiotics (R2), and those requiring antifungal therapy (RAF). Median values of IL-6 and CRP were compared between the groups. RESULTS: There were 57 episodes of febrile neutropenia among 26 patients younger than 25 years during 1 year of study period. On day 1, median IL-6 level was significantly lower in FUO group compared with CDI+MDI groups combined (P < 0.001). Rise in CRP on day 3 was highly significant to differentiate MDI group from other 2 groups (P < 0.001). The CRP also increased significantly on day 3 in RAF (P < 0.001) and R2 (P = 0.002) groups than in R1 group. CONCLUSIONS: Low level of IL-6 may help differentiate patients with FUO from those with documented infections. A rising CRP is indicative of serious infection.

PURPOSE: Conventional methods like smear and culture for Mycobacterium tuberculosis are of limited sensitivity and specificity. Histopathological examination (HPE) for the tissues obtained gives inconclusive diagnosis in the absence of caseous necrosis or stained acid-fast bacilli. This study was conducted to determine the utility of tissue PCR for diagnosing tuberculosis of the genitourinary tract (GUTB) and its comparative evaluation with HPE. PATIENTS AND METHODS: A prospective study was conducted from January 2006 to August 2009 with 78 tissue specimens (renal, prostate, epididymis, penile and soft tissue) from patients with clinically suspected GUTB. All the samples were processed for both PCR and histopathology. RESULTS: In 68 (87.1%) samples, results for both PCR and HPE were coinciding. False positivity and false negativity was observed in 5.1% (4/78) and 7.6% (6/78) samples, respectively. With HPE as the gold standard, PCR has shown sensitivity of 87.5% (95% CI 80.1; 91.9) and specificity of 86.7% (95% CI 74.9; 93.8) and positive agreement between two tests was observed as significant (0.7). PCR results were obtained within a mean period of 3.4 days while those of HPE were obtained in 7.2 days. CONCLUSIONS: Tissue PCR is a sensitive and specific method for obtaining early and timely diagnosis of GUTB. Application of tissue PCR results can augment the diagnostic accuracy in histopathologically labelled granulomatous inflammations.

OBJECTIVE: To determine the frequency of underlying risk factors and the socio-economic impact based on occupation in the development of tuberculosis. METHOD: Retrospective analysis of 207 clinically and microbiologically diagnosed patients with pulmonary tuberculosis (PTB) admitted to Kasturba Hospital in 2005 and 2006. Demographic details and underlying risk factors were statistically evaluated. RESULTS: Diabetes mellitus (DM) (30.9%) was the most prevalent condition and significantly more common than other risk factors like smoking (16.9%), alcoholism (12.6%), HIV (10.6%), malignancy (5.8%), chronic liver diseases (3.9%), history of contact with TB (3.4%), chronic corticosteroid therapy (2.9%), chronic kidney diseases and malnourishment (1.5%). There were 82 patients (39.6%) with no underlying risk factor. Men (M:F = 3.7:1) and patients older than 40 years had a higher incidence of co-existing conditions. PTB was significantly more common in blue-collar (44%) and white-collar (27.1%) workers than household workers (12.1%), students (10.6%) and retired/unemployed people (6.3%). CONCLUSION: Pulmonary tuberculosis had a significant impact and predominated in male patients co-existing with DM. Patients with DM and suggestive pulmonary symptoms should be screened for tuberculosis. More stringent health education and awareness programme should be implemented at the grass root level.

The development of oral cancer proceeds through discrete molecular changes that are acquired from loss of genomic integrity after continued exposure to environmental risk factors. It is preceded in the majority of cases by clinically evident oral potentially malignant disorders, the most common of which is leukoplakia. Early detection of these oral lesions by screening methods using suitable markers is critical as it mirrors molecular alterations, long before cancer phenotypes are manifested. Assessment of salivary interleukin-6 (IL-6) as a marker of malignant progression was undertaken in patients with leukoplakia having coexisting periodontitis (n = 20), periodontitis patients without leukoplakia (n = 20), and healthy controls (n = 20) by competitive enzyme-linked immunosorbent assay. Results showed elevation of IL-6 levels in leukoplakia with coexisting periodontitis and in periodontitis patients when compared to healthy control (P < 0.001). Within the leukoplakia group, IL-6 level was found to be increased with increase in the severity of dysplasia. The use of tobacco was seen to play a significant role in the elevation of salivary IL-6.The importance of IL-6 as a specific marker for leukoplakia with dysplasia and the role of tobacco as an independent risk factor has been highlighted.

The increasing trend of gut colonization by extended-spectrum ß-lactamase (ESBL) producing Enterobacterales has been observed in conventional farm animals and their owners. Still, such colonization among domesticated organically fed livestock has not been well studied. This study aimed to determine the gut colonization rate of ESBL-producing Enterobacteriaceae and carbapenemase-producing Enterobacteriaceae (CPE) among rural subsistence farming communities of the Kaski district in Nepal. Rectal swabs collected by systematic random sampling from 128 households of subsistence farming communities were screened for ESBL-producing Enterobacteriaceae and CPE by phenotypic and molecular methods. A total of 357 (57%) ESBL-producing Enterobacteriaceae isolates were obtained from 626 specimens, which included 97 ESBL-producing Enterobacteriaceae (75.8%) from 128 adult humans, 101 (79.5%) from 127 of their children, 51 (47.7%) from 107 cattle, 26 (51%) from 51 goats, 30 (34.9%) from 86 poultry and 52 (42%) from 127 environmental samples. No CPE was isolated from any of the samples. blaCTX-M-15 was the most predominant gene found in animal (86.8%) and human (80.5%) isolates. Out of 308 Escherichia coli isolates, 16 human and two poultry isolates were positive for ST131 and were of clade C. Among non-cephalosporin antibiotics, the resistance rates were observed slightly higher in tetracycline and ciprofloxacin among all study subjects. This is the first one-health study in Nepal, demonstrating the high rate of CTX-M-15 type ESBL-producing Enterobacteriaceae among gut flora of subsistence-based farming communities. Gut colonization by E. coli ST131 clade C among healthy farmers and poultry birds is a consequential public health concern.

The surge in the prevalence of drug-resistant bacteria in poultry is a global concern as it may pose an extended threat to humans and animal health. The present study aimed to investigate the colonization proportion of extended-spectrum ß-lactamase (ESBL) and carbapenemase-producing Enterobacteriaceae (EPE and CPE, respectively) in the gut of healthy poultry, Gallus gallus domesticus in Kaski district of Western Nepal. Total, 113 pooled rectal swab specimens from 66 private household farms and 47 commercial poultry farms were collected by systematic random sampling from the Kaski district in western Nepal. Out of 113 pooled samples, 19 (28.8%) samples from 66 backyard farms, and 15 (31.9%) from 47 commercial broiler farms were positive for EPE. Of the 38 EPE strains isolated from 34 ESBL positive rectal swabs, 31(81.6%) were identified as Escherichia coli, five as Klebsiella pneumoniae (13.2%), and one each isolate of Enterobacter species and Citrobacter species (2.6%). Based on genotyping, 35/38 examined EPE strains (92.1%) were phylogroup-1 positive, and all these 35 strains (100%) had the CTX-M-15 gene and strains from phylogroup-2, and 9 were of CTX-M-2 and CTX-M-14, respectively. Among 38 ESBL positive isolates, 9 (23.7%) were Ambler class C (Amp C) co-producers, predominant were of DHA, followed by CIT genes. Two (6.5%) E. coli strains of ST131 belonged to clade C, rest 29/31 (93.5%) were non-ST131 E. coli. None of the isolates produced carbapenemase. Twenty isolates (52.6%) were in-vitro biofilm producers. Univariate analysis showed that the odd of ESBL carriage among commercial broilers were 1.160 times (95% CI 0.515, 2.613) higher than organically fed backyard flocks. This is the first study in Nepal, demonstrating the EPE colonization proportion, genotypes, and prevalence of high-risk clone E. coli ST131 among gut flora of healthy poultry. Our data indicated that CTX-M-15 was the most prevalent ESBL enzyme, mainly associated with E. coli belonging to non-ST131clones and the absence of carbapenemases.

BACKGROUND: The new guidelines issued by the Revised National Tuberculosis Control Programme for diagnosis of smear-positive tuberculosis recommend examination of only 2 sputum smears. We did a retrospective analysis of data from a designated microscopy centre to ascertain the diagnostic yield of 2 smears and the additional yield provided by the third smear. METHODS: Data were obtained from the designated microscopy centre attached to our medical college. A total of 3257 patients with suspected tuberculosis had undergone sputum examination between September 2004 and March 2009. However, only 1762 of them had 3 sputum specimens examined. Data were entered and analysed using SPSS version 11.5. RESULTS: Among the 1762 suspected patients, positivity in any 2 samples was found to be 17.7% while 19% were found to be positive in a single smear. A statistically insignificant association was found between the grading and positivity of the sputum samples using McNemar test. A positive third sample was found in 309 patients. If the first 2 samples were negative, the possibility of missing a third positive sample was 0.4%. CONCLUSION: Under field conditions, 2 sputum smears are as effective as 3 smears for diagnosing smear-positive tuberculosis.

Nocardia farcinica is an infrequent cause of nocardiosis among the renal transplant recipients and it has not been reported so far from India. We report a case of pulmonary nocardiosis due to N. farcinica in a 32-year-old woman with hypothyroidism and post-renal transplant status, currently on immunosuppressive therapy (prednisolone, azathioprine and tacrolimus). The N. farcinica isolate was susceptible to trimethoprim-sulfamethoxazole (TMP-SMZ), linezolid, imipenem, gentamicin but resistant to ceftriaxone, ciprofloxacin, tobramycin, erythromycin, amoxycillin-clavulanic acid and tetracycline. Treatment with TMP-SMZ and linezolid resulted in marked clinico-radiological improvement but after two weeks both of the drugs had to be stopped due to severe pancytopenia as adverse effect of their use. Currently, the patient is on imipenem and remains stable after four weeks of treatment. In N. farcinica infections, multi antibiotic resistance and toxicity of some specific drugs enhances the risk of therapeutic failure in renal transplant recipients.

In developing countries pulmonary tuberculosis is usually diagnosed by detecting acid-fast bacilli (AFB) in sputum using a Ziehl-Neelsen (Z-N) staining method. However, in the field the traditional method of staining is difficult to carry out. This study evaluates the efficiency of two cold staining methods, namely Gabbet's and a modified two reagent cold staining method compared with the Z-N taken as the gold standard. Triplicate smears were prepared from 267 sputum samples and stained by the Z-N, Gabbet's, and a modified cold staining method, the smears were positive for AFB in 21 (7.87%), 18 (6.74%) and 19 (7.12%), respectively. The sensitivities for the Gabbet's and modified cold stain were 85.7% and 90.5%, respectively. The positive agreement between the Z-N and Gabbet's (92.3%) and Z-N and modified cold stain (95%) were good. The modified cold staining method was less time consuming and easier to perform in the field.
